Output ed408a637251b465cf2a2730474daea220ae601ee6d9614528127b8f5a38bb4d:7

value
18090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4540e4646ab7053213a302c114338e8640e45a54 OP_EQUAL
address
MEDLbTCrXiUsUDahNuNKYCu6AWXuNBmhAC
transaction
ed408a637251b465cf2a2730474daea220ae601ee6d9614528127b8f5a38bb4d
spent
true